mangle

/mˈæŋgʌl/

Explore definitions, synonyms, and language insights of mangle

Definitions

Noun
clothes dryer for drying and ironing laundry by passing it between two heavy heated rollers
Verb
press with a mangle; "mangle the sheets"
Verb
injure badly by beating
Verb
alter so as to make unrecognizable; "The tourists murdered the French language"
Verb
destroy or injure severely; "The madman mutilates art work"